The Bank of Palatine is a locally owned and operated financial institution that has been providing banking services to the Palatine area since 1965. The bank is a member of the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ation (FDIC) and is classified as a commercial bank. It is headquartered in Palatine, Illinois, and serves the surrounding communities of the Chicago metropolitan area.

The Bank of Palatine was founded in 1965 as a locally owned and operated financial institution. It was originally established as a savings and loan association, and in the early years of its existence, it was a small, local bank. Over the years, the bank has grown and now offers a wide range of banking services to its customers. These services include checking and savings accounts, loans, online banking, and more.
